use crate::arch::SE_PAGE_SHIFT;
use crate::call::{ocall, OCallIndex, OcAlloc};
use alloc::boxed::Box;
use sgx_types::error::{SgxResult, SgxStatus};
#[repr(C)]
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Default)]
struct TrimRangeOcall {
from: usize,
to: usize,
}
#[repr(C)]
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Default)]
struct TrimRangeCommitOcall {
addr: usize,
}
pub fn trim_range(addr: usize, count: usize) -> SgxResult {
let mut trim = Box::try_new_in(
TrimRangeOcall {
from: addr,
to: addr + (count << SE_PAGE_SHIFT),
},
OcAlloc,
)
.map_err(|_| SgxStatus::OutOfMemory)?;
ocall(OCallIndex::Trim, Some(trim.as_mut()))
}
pub fn trim_range_commit(addr: usize, count: usize) -> SgxResult {
for i in 0..count {
let mut trim = Box::try_new_in(
TrimRangeCommitOcall {
addr: addr + (i << SE_PAGE_SHIFT),
},
OcAlloc,
)
.map_err(|_| SgxStatus::OutOfMemory)?;
ocall(OCallIndex::TrimCommit, Some(trim.as_mut()))?;
}
Ok(())
}
